Betty Marion White Ludden was an American actress and comedian. A pioneer of early television, with a career spanning over eight decades, White was noted for her vast work in the entertainment industry and being one of the first women to work both in front of and behind the camera. After an early career in radio, she transitioned to television, where after her initial sitcom work she became a game show staple. Her roles took her from soap operas to sketch comedies to legal comedy-dramas, but she is perhaps best known to contemporary audiences as Rose from The Golden Girls. A holder of a Guinness World Record (Longest TV Career by an Entertainer (Female)), she was also the recipient of eight Emmy Awards, three SAG Awards, and a Grammy Award.
